Add support for returning threads by either `created_at` OR `updated_at` descending. Previously core always returned threads ordered by `created_at`. This PR: - updates core to be able to list threads by `updated_at` OR `created_at` descending based on what the caller wants - also update `thread/list` in app-server to expose this (default to `created_at` if not specified) All existing codepaths (app-server, TUI) still default to `created_at`, so no behavior change is expected with this PR. **Implementation** To sort by `updated_at` is a bit nontrivial (whereas `created_at` is easy due to the way we structure the folders and filenames on disk, which are all based on `created_at`). The most naive way to do this without introducing a cache file or sqlite DB (which we have to implement/maintain) is to scan files in reverse `created_at` order on disk, and look at the file's mtime (last modified timestamp according to the filesystem) until we reach `MAX_SCAN_FILES` (currently set to 10,000). Then, we can return the most recent N threads. Based on some quick and dirty benchmarking on my machine with ~1000 rollout files, calling `thread/list` with limit 50, the `updated_at` path is slower as expected due to all the I/O: - updated-at: average 103.10 ms - created-at: average 41.10 ms Those absolute numbers aren't a big deal IMO, but we can certainly optimize this in a followup if needed by introducing more state stored on disk. **Caveat** There's also a limitation in that any files older than `MAX_SCAN_FILES` will be excluded, which means if a user continues a REALLY old thread, it's possible to not be included. In practice that should not be too big of an issue. If a user makes... - 1000 rollouts/day → threads older than 10 days won't show up - 100 rollouts/day → ~100 days If this becomes a problem for some reason, even more motivation to implement an updated_at cache.

Codex CLI is a coding agent from OpenAI that runs locally on your computer.

Quickstart
Installing and running Codex CLI
Install globally with your preferred package manager:
# Install using npm
npm install -g @openai/codex
# Install using Homebrew
brew install --cask codex
Then simply run codex to get started.
You can also go to the latest GitHub Release and download the appropriate binary for your platform.
Each GitHub Release contains many executables, but in practice, you likely want one of these:

Each archive contains a single entry with the platform baked into the name (e.g., codex-x86_64-unknown-linux-musl), so you likely want to rename it to codex after extracting it.
Using Codex with your ChatGPT plan
Run codex and select Sign in with ChatGPT. We recommend signing into your ChatGPT account to use Codex as part of your Plus, Pro, Team, Edu, or Enterprise plan. Learn more about what's included in your ChatGPT plan.
You can also use Codex with an API key, but this requires additional setup.
